#8E9ADC Color
#8E9ADC is rgb(142, 154, 220) in RGB, hsl(231, 53%, 71%) in HSL, and about cmyk(35%, 30%, 0%, 14%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Vista Blue (#7C9ED9),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 8.11.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#8E9ADC Channel Values
How #8E9ADC bre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 142 · G 154 · B 220 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 231° · S 53% · L 71%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 231° · S 35% · V 86%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 35% · M 30% · Y 0% · K 14%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 2.69:1 vs white · 7.81: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#8E9ADC background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#8E9ADC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#8E9ADC?
#8E9ADC is a light blue — rgb(142, 154, 220) in RGB and hsl(231, 53%, 71%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Vista Blue (#7C9ED9),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 8.11.
What is the RGB value of #8E9ADC?
#8E9ADC is rgb(142, 154, 220) — red 142, green 154, and blue 220 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#8E9ADC?
#8E9ADC converts to approximately cmyk(35%, 30%, 0%, 14%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#8E9ADC be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#8E9ADC scores 2.69:1 against white and 7.81: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#8E9ADC as a CSS color keyword?
No. #8E9ADC is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is cornflowerblue (#6495ED) at a CIE76 distance of 15.84, which is visibly different.
